From The Trussville Tribune staff reports
TRUSSVILLE — Trussville will be among other cities where the American Red Cross will be present to collect donations as part of its “Missing Types” campaign to prevent blood shortages this summer.
On July 5, the American Red Cross will be at Trussville Civic Center from 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. The “Missing Types” campaign aims to raise awareness about shortages and the need for donors.
“While thousands of donors have answered the call to donate blood, more donors are needed now to help ensure blood types don’t go missing,” Red Cross said in a statement. “During the summer, especially around holidays like Independence Day, donations often don’t keep pace with patient needs.”
